ICON plc in Reading, UK is looking for a Portfolio Manager to own high-complexity clinical studies and client relationships. You will lead and support Project Managers, driving successful outcomes while fostering a positive team culture.

The role requires a strong background in Interactive Response Technology and clinical trials, with 5–10 years of project management experience. ICON offers a hybrid work model and a range of competitive benefits.
